Summary
This PR improves the hover state of the "Become a Sponsor" button in the support section.
Previously, when hovering over the button, the visual state looked unclear and unpolished because the text lost contrast against the background which made the CTA feel less professional. This change updates the hover styling so the button remains clear, readable and visually consistent with webpack’s blue brand styling.
